DANNY Simpson insists right-back rival Ryan Taylor has the perfect credentials to fill Newcastle United's troublesome defensive slot when the Premier League season kicks off. United are pondering whether to make a move into the transfer market to find a replacement for Simpson, who will be missing until late September after rupturing a tendon in his ankle.
